…anatomically, they are close to the family Corvidae. They are divided into three genera and three species in the subfamily Parasitinae and 17 genera and 37 species in the subfamily Parasitinae. All of them live in New Guinea and its associated islands, except for a few species found in the Maluku Islands or Australia. All species live in forests, and their distribution ranges range from the plains to the high mountains. … *Some of the terminology that refers to the subfamily "Crested Paradoxinae" is listed below.
